University of Manchester Uses NVIDIA Earth-2 to Forecast Air Pollution Across the UK

University of Manchester retrained NVIDIA Earth-2 CorrDiff and StormCast on Isambard-AI to forecast UK air pollution at 2-3 km resolution.

University of Manchester researchers led by professor David Topping adapted NVIDIA's Earth-2 generative AI frameworks to forecast air pollution across the UK. Earth-2 CorrDiff was retrained in two days on a single eight-GPU node of Isambard-AI (5,448 GH200 Grace Hopper Superchips, 21 exaflops) using a year of hourly simulated pollution data, producing a UK-wide model at 2-3 square kilometer resolution. The team added Earth-2 StormCast for time-dependent forecasts that ingest real air quality observations, and demonstrated the workflow runs on the DGX Spark desktop AI system. Open-source training data and workflows are planned so other countries and cities can build similar pollution models.

Robots are waiting for a ChatGPT moment: Nvidia’s Les Karpas explains why at TechCrunch Disrupt 2026

NVIDIA Inception's Les Karpas will discuss at TechCrunch Disrupt 2026 why robotics lacks a ChatGPT moment, citing missing internet-scale physical AI datasets.

NVIDIA Inception's Global Head of Physical AI, Les Karpas, will speak on the Real World AI Stage at TechCrunch Disrupt 2026, held October 13-15 at San Francisco's Moscone West. His core argument is that general-purpose robots lack an internet-wide dataset for physical AI, unlike language models from OpenAI and Anthropic. Founders from Shield AI, Colossal Biosciences, FieldAI, and Foxglove will join related sessions.

Building the materials foundation for AI

Syensqo's CTO says AI pushes semiconductors and data centers to physical limits, driving advanced materials demand and AI-accelerated materials discovery.

MIT Technology Review's Business Lab podcast, produced in partnership with Syensqo, features CTO Mike Finelli discussing how AI workloads push semiconductors and data centers to physical limits in performance, thermal management, and reliability. Syensqo develops high-voltage data center materials, semiconductor sealing materials, and immersion cooling fluids, while using AI agents to digitally synthesize millions of molecular combinations and predict performance before lab testing. Finelli describes a reinforcing cycle where AI improves materials that in turn enable better AI infrastructure.

Top 10 Best Cloud Detection & Response (CDR) Solutions in 2026

Editorial scorecard ranks ten 2026 cloud detection and response platforms; Sysdig, Wiz, and CrowdStrike lead, with Wiz's Gem Security acquisition highlighted.

The editorial scorecard rates ten CDR platforms on real-time detection (30%), cloud telemetry depth, response automation, correlation, and value. Sysdig earns the best real-time detection score for its Falco- and eBPF-powered runtime telemetry, Wiz (8.7) folds acquired Gem Security's real-time CDR into its security graph, and CrowdStrike (8.7) leads response automation. Specialists Stream.Security, Skyhawk Security, Sweet Security, and the open-source Falco project are also assessed.
